RuWeb.net - хостинг и регистрация доменных имен
ГЛАВНАЯ ХОСТИНГ ДОМЕНЫ VDS СЕРВЕР ИНФОРМАЦИЯ КЛИЕНТЫ ПРАВИЛА ОПЛАТА ЗАКАЗ ФОРУМ
go to bottom

Версия для печати | Подписаться | Добавить в избранное   Создать новую тему Опрос: Ответ на сообщение
Автор: Тема: Предустанавливаемый XMB Magic Latern
support
Super Administrator
*********




Сообщения: 1774
Зарегистрирован: 2.7.2002
Пользователя нет на форуме

[*] когда размещено 1.8.2002 в 06:11 Ответить с цитированием
Предустанавливаемый XMB Magic Latern


Тем, кто установит XMB форум из CPanel, наверное будет нужно внести некоторые багфиксы.
Официальный фикс проблемы с PID-ом (не работает правка сообщений и цитирование):
В файле viewthread.php найти строчку

Код:
$querypost = $db->query("SELECT p.*, a.*, m.* FROM $table_posts p LEFT JOIN $table_members m ON m.username=p.author LEFT JOIN $table_attachments a ON a.pid=p.pid WHERE p.fid='$fid' AND p.tid='$tid' ORDER BY dateline LIMIT $start_limit, $ppp");
и заменить ее на
Код:
$querypost = $db->query("SELECT p.*, a.aid, a.filename, a.filetype, a.filesize, a.attachment, a.downloads, m.* FROM $table_posts p LEFT JOIN $table_members m ON m.username=p.author LEFT JOIN $table_attachments a ON a.pid=p.pid AND a.tid=p.tid WHERE p.fid='$fid' AND p.tid='$tid' ORDER BY dateline LIMIT $start_limit, $ppp");
Взято отсюда
Просмотреть Профиль Пользователя Посетить Домашнюю Страницу Пользователя Просмотреть все сообщения этого пользователя Отправить пользователю личное сообщение
support
Super Administrator
*********




Сообщения: 1774
Зарегистрирован: 2.7.2002
Пользователя нет на форуме

[*] когда размещено 1.8.2002 в 06:31 Ответить с цитированием


Фикс проблемы с неправильным отображением списка присутствующих на форуме:
В index.php найти

Код:
while($online = $db->fetch_array($query)) {
switch($online[username]) {
case xguest123:
$guestcount++;
break;

default:
$member[$membercount] = $online;
$membercount++;
break;
}
}
if(!$guestcount) {
$guestcount = "0";
}
if(!$membercount) {
$membercount = "0";
}
$onlinenum = $guestcount + $membercount;
заменить
Код:
$query = $db->query("SELECT w.*, m.status, m.username FROM $table_whosonline w LEFT JOIN $table_members m ON m.username=w.username WHERE w.username = m.username ORDER BY w.username");
while($online = $db->fetch_array($query)) {
$member[$membercount] = $online;
$membercount++;
}
$onlinenum = $db->result($db->query("SELECT count(username) FROM $table_whosonline"), 0);
$guestcount = $onlinenum - $membercount;

Взято тут
Просмотреть Профиль Пользователя Посетить Домашнюю Страницу Пользователя Просмотреть все сообщения этого пользователя Отправить пользователю личное сообщение
Создать новую тему Опрос: Ответ на сообщение

 » Быстрый Ответ - [Вы вошли как ]
Пожалуйста введите код показанный на картинке в поле расположенное под ней. Это нужно для предотвращения регистрации автоматических ботов.

Проверка Рисунком Captcha

HTML - Выкл.
Смайлики включены Вкл.
BB-код - Вкл.
[img] код - Вкл.

Отключить смайлики?
Использовать подпись?
Выключить BB-код?
Получать уведомления на e-mail об ответе?

  

Powered by XMB
Разработано Группа XMB © 2001-2008
[запросов: 21] [PHP: 64.9% - SQL: 35.1%]
go to top
Центр поддержки (круглосуточно)
https://ruweb.net/support/
Москва(499) 502-44-31
Санкт-Петербург(812) 336-42-55
Нижний Новгород(831) 411-12-44
Екатеринбург(343) 204-71-16
© 2002-2013 ЗАО "РУВЕБ"

Дизайн - CredoDesign
Rambler\'s Top100 Рейтинг@Mail.ru
RuWeb.net - Хостинг веб-сайтов (первый месяц - бесплатно). Регистрация доменов.